Description

Recorded under the castle in Lewes, East Sussex, 'Lore of the Land' is the debut release from The Order of the 12. Featuring Rachel Thomas on vocals, with Stuart Carter on guitars, and Richard Norris on keyboards, drums and production. The music looks to the South Downs and the Sussex folk tradition for inspiration, with echoes of psych folk acts like Trees or Mellow Candle.
